Packaging liner and packaging assembly
By designing a special groove in the inner lining of the lighting device packaging, the lamp head and lamp holder can be stacked, and the lamp pole can be laid flat, which solves the problem of the large thickness of the packaging components and achieves material saving and improved transportation efficiency.

TECHNICAL FIELD
[0001] The utility model relates to the packaging technical field of lighting device especially relates to a kind of packing liner and packing assembly. BACKGROUND
[0002] Lighting device is widely used in road, square, park and other public places as important component of city infrastructure.In order to ensure that lighting device is not damaged in transportation and storage process, it is usually necessary to be properly packaged.The existing packaging assembly of lighting device can protect product to some extent, but there is the problem of thick packaging, which will lead to material waste, low transportation efficiency, inconvenient disassembly and other problems. UTILITY MODEL CONTENT
[0003] The utility model discloses a kind of packing liner and packing assembly, to solve the problem of thick packaging assembly in the related art.
[0004] To solve the above technical problems, the utility model is realized as follows:
[0005] Firstly, the application discloses a kind of packing liner, for packaging lighting device, the lighting device includes lamp head, lamp holder and lamp pole, the packing liner includes liner main body, the liner main body is equipped with the first recess for placing lamp head, the second recess for placing lamp holder and the third recess for placing lamp pole, the second recess is set in the bottom wall of the first recess, the third recess is located with the first recess in the same side of the liner main body, and interval distribution.
[0006] Secondly, the application also discloses a kind of packing assembly, the disclosed packing assembly includes packing box and the packing liner of first aspect, the packing liner is installed in the packing box.
[0007] The technical scheme of the utility model can achieve the following technical effects:
[0008] The packaging liner disclosed in this application has a first groove, a second groove, and a third groove formed on the liner body. The second groove is formed on the bottom wall of the first groove, and the third groove is located on the same side of the liner body and spaced apart. This allows the lamp holder to be placed in the second groove and the lamp head in the first groove, with the lamp head and lamp holder overlapping in the thickness direction of the packaging liner. Since the lamp head and lamp holder are relatively thin, the space occupied by the lamp head and lamp holder in the thickness direction of the liner body after being stacked in the corresponding grooves is small, which is beneficial to the thinning of the liner body. Furthermore, by placing the lamp pole in the third groove, which is spaced apart from the first groove, the lamp pole and lamp head are laid flat in the direction perpendicular to the thickness direction, thereby avoiding overlapping in the thickness direction of the liner body, which is beneficial to further thinning of the liner body, and thus to reducing the overall thickness of the packaging assembly. [0028] Please refer to Figures 1 to 12 The utility model embodiment discloses a kind of packing liners, the disclosed packing liner is used to package lighting device, lighting device can be street lamp, desk lamp etc., and the size of packing liner is designed according to the type of lighting device.
[0029] Lighting device includes lamp holder 310, lamp holder 320 and lamp rod 330.
[0030] The packaging liner comprises a liner body 100, the liner body 100 is provided with a first groove 110 for placing a lamp head 310, a second groove 120 for placing a lamp base 320 and a third groove 130 for placing a lamp rod 330. The second groove 120 is provided on the bottom wall of the first groove 110, the third groove 130 is located on the same side of the liner body 100 as the first groove 110, and is spaced apart. The first groove 110 can be slotted along the thickness direction of the liner body 100. The liner body 100 can be made of EPS foam (Expanded Polystyrene Foam), of course, the liner body 100 can also be made of other materials, such as hardboard material, etc., the material of the liner body 100 is not limited in the embodiment of the application.
[0031] In the process of packaging the lighting device in the packaging liner, the lamp base 320 is first placed in the second groove 120, supported on the bottom wall of the second groove 120, then the lamp head 310 is placed in the first groove 110, supported on the bottom wall of the first groove 110, and then the lamp rod 330 is placed in the third groove 130, of course, the order of placing the lamp rod 330 can be before the lamp head 310 and the lamp base 320, the order of placing the lamp rod 330 is not limited in the embodiment of the application.
[0032] It should be noted that when the lamp base 320 is placed in the second groove 120, at least part of the side wall of the second groove 120 is in contact with the lamp base 320 to limit the lamp base 320 from shaking in the second groove 120. When the lamp head 310 is placed in the first groove 110, at least part of the side wall of the first groove 110 is in contact with the lamp head 310 to limit the lamp head 310 from shaking in the first groove 110. When the lamp rod 330 is placed in the third groove 130, at least part of the side wall of the third groove 130 is in contact with the lamp rod 330 to limit the lamp rod 330 from shaking in the third groove 130.
[0033] The packaging liner disclosed by the embodiments of the present application is characterized in that a first groove 110, a second groove 120 and a third groove 130 are formed on the inner liner body 100, the second groove 120 is formed on the bottom wall of the first groove 110, the third groove 130 is located on the same side of the inner liner body 100 as the first groove 110 and is spaced apart, so that when the lamp holder 310 is placed in the second groove 120 and the lamp holder 310 is placed in the first groove 110, the lamp holder 310 and the lamp holder 320 are stacked in the thickness direction of the packaging liner. Since the lamp holder 310 and the lamp holder 320 are relatively thin, the space occupied by the lamp holder 310 and the lamp holder 320 in the thickness direction of the inner liner body 100 is small after being stacked in the corresponding grooves, thereby facilitating the thinning of the inner liner body 100. By placing the lamp rod 330 in the third groove 130 spaced apart from the first groove 110, the lamp rod 330 and the lamp holder 310 are arranged in a flat manner in a direction perpendicular to the thickness direction, thereby avoiding stacking in the thickness direction of the inner liner body 100, and further facilitating the thinning of the inner liner body 100, thereby facilitating the reduction of the thickness of the packaging liner.
[0034] The lamp holder 320 has a lamp rod mounting protrusion 321 for mounting the lamp rod 330, and the lamp rod 330 can be mounted on the lamp holder 320 through the lamp rod mounting protrusion 321. To further reduce the thickness of the inner liner body 100, the bottom wall of the second groove 120 can optionally be provided with an avoiding hole 121 for avoiding the lamp rod mounting protrusion 321, and the avoiding hole 121 can be used to avoid the lamp rod mounting protrusion 321. When the lamp holder 320 is placed in the second groove 120, the lamp rod mounting protrusion 321 of the lamp holder 320 can extend into the avoiding hole 121, thereby avoiding the lamp rod mounting protrusion 321 from being supported by the bottom wall of the second groove 120 to cause the lamp holder 320 to be lifted up, and thus the depth of the second groove 120 does not need to be increased, thereby facilitating the thinning of the inner liner body 100.
[0035] Optionally, the bottom wall of the first groove 110 is provided with a first avoiding groove 140 communicating with the second groove 120, and the first avoiding groove 140 is used for the hands or operating tools of the operator to extend into, so as to facilitate the hands or operating tools of the operator to place the lamp holder 320 in the second groove 120 or take the lamp holder 320 out of the second groove 120.
[0036] Optionally, the lamp holder 320 can have a lamp rod mounting protrusion 321 for mounting the lamp rod 330, and the bottom wall of the second groove 120 can be provided with an avoiding hole 121 for avoiding the lamp rod mounting protrusion 321, and the avoiding hole 121 can be used to avoid the lamp rod mounting protrusion 321. The bottom wall of the second groove 120 can be flush with the bottom wall of the first avoiding groove 140, the bottom wall of the first avoiding groove 140 is provided with a second avoiding groove 150, and the second avoiding groove 150 communicates with the avoiding hole 121.
[0037] The packaging liner disclosed by the embodiment of the present application opens the second avoiding slot 150 at the bottom wall of the first avoiding slot 140, so that the second avoiding slot 150 is communicated with the avoiding hole 121, so that the hand or the operating tool of the operator can be inserted into the bottom of the lamp holder 320 through the second avoiding slot 150, so as to facilitate the hand or the operating tool of the operator to place the lamp holder 320 in the second groove 120 or take out the lamp holder 320 from the second groove 120.
[0038] Optionally, the inner liner body 100 can also be opened with a third avoiding slot 160, the third avoiding slot 160 can be communicated with the first groove 110, and the bottom wall of the third avoiding slot 160 can be flush with the bottom wall of the second groove 120, the third avoiding slot 160 can be used for the hand or the operating tool of the operator to be inserted.
[0039] The packaging liner disclosed by the embodiment of the present application opens the third avoiding slot 160, so that when the lamp holder 310 is placed in the first groove 110, the hand or the operating tool of the operator can operate the lamp holder 310 through the third avoiding slot 160, so as to facilitate the lamp holder 310 to be placed in the third avoiding slot 160 or taken out from the third avoiding slot 160.
[0040] It should be noted that the slot opening direction of the third avoiding slot 160 is perpendicular to the slot opening direction of the first avoiding slot 140.
[0041] The lamp rod 330 usually has a plurality, and the plurality of lamp rods 330 are spliced to form an overall structure, for example. The plurality of lamp rods 330 can include a first lamp rod 330a and a second lamp rod 330b. The third groove 130 can be a plurality, and in the case of even number of the third groove 130, the plurality of third grooves 130 can be symmetrically opened on both sides of the first groove 110, and the plurality of lamp rods 330 can be placed in the plurality of third grooves 130 one by one.
[0042] Optionally, the length of the lamp rod 330 can be greater than the length of the lamp holder 310, and the third groove 130 and the first groove 110 are distributed in the length direction perpendicular to the length of the first groove 110, and the two ends of the third groove 130 in the length direction are outside the two ends of the first groove 110 in the length direction.
[0043] The packaging liner disclosed by the embodiment of the present application extends the two ends of the third groove 130 in the length direction beyond the two ends of the first groove 110 in the length direction, so that when the lamp holder 310 is placed in the first groove 110 and the lamp rod 330 is placed in the third groove 130, the two ends of the lamp rod 330 in the length direction of the third groove 130 extend out of the lamp holder 310, so that the lamp holder 310 can be protected, so as to avoid damaging the lamp holder 310 when the inner liner body 100 is pressed in the length direction of the third groove 130.
[0044] In order to accommodate the connecting line 331 of the end of the lamp pole 330, optionally, the inner liner body 100 can further be provided with a fourth recess 170, which can be in communication with the end of the third recess 130, and the fourth recess 170 is used to accommodate the connecting line 331 of the end of the lamp pole 330.
[0045] In order to protect the lamp head 310, optionally, the packaging liner can further include a protective cotton piece 200, which can be arranged above the lamp holder 320 when the lamp holder 320 is placed in the second recess 120, so that the lamp head 310 and the lamp holder 320 can be isolated by the protective cotton piece 200 after the lamp head 310 is placed in the first recess 110, thereby protecting the lamp head 310.
[0046] Specifically, the protective cotton piece 200 can be polyethylene foam (also known as EPE pearl cotton). Of course, the protective cotton piece 200 can also be other materials, and the material of the protective cotton piece 200 is not limited in the present application.
[0047] Optionally, the packaging liner can further include an upper cover 400, which can be used to cover the side of the slot of the first recess 110 of the inner liner body 100. By arranging the upper cover 400 to cover the side of the slot of the first recess 110 of the inner liner body 100, the lighting device can be better packaged.
[0048] Optionally, the inner liner body 100 can further be provided with a connecting piece placing groove 180, which can be used to place the connecting pieces of the components of the assembled lighting assembly, such as connecting bolts.
[0049] The present application further discloses a packaging assembly, which includes a packaging box and the packaging liner disclosed in the above embodiments, and the packaging liner is installed in the packaging box.
